In land to Dalat, int he mountains

We then headed inland to Da Lat, which is in the mountains. It's a beautiful city with lots of crazy buildings. They are only recently used to receiving tourists, and it is in Dalat that I realised that everyone in Vietnam is very small, and I looked like a giant amongst the locals!
